Ingredients
1 pound ground beef
4 cups potatoes, diced small
1 tablespoon olive oil
1 medium onion, diced
1 bell pepper, diced
3 cloves garlic, minced
1 teaspoon paprika
1 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on black pepper
1/4 teaspoon crushed red pepper flakes
2 green onions, sliced
Instructions
1. Heat the ol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at.
2. Add the diced potatoes and cook for 10 to 12 minutes, stirring occasionally, until they begin to turn golden and tender.
3. Add the ground beef to the skillet and break it apart with a spoon.
4. Cook the beef until browned and no longer pink.
5. Stir in the onion and bell pepper and cook for 3 to 4 minutes until softened.
6. Add the garlic, paprika, salt, black pepper, and crushed red pepper flakes.
7. Stir everything together and cook for another 5 to 7 minutes until the potatoes are crispy on the edges and the beef is deeply browned.
8. Top with sliced green onions and serve hot.
Notes
Use a large skillet so the potatoes have room to crisp instead of steaming.
Cut the potatoes into even small cubes for faster and more even cooking.
For the best texture, reheat leftovers in a skillet instead of the microwave.
